Geographic analytics shows where your site visitors or customers are located through an interactive heat map and detailed data tables. This data helps you understand visitor distribution, optimize marketing efforts, and track business growth.

Accessing Geography Analytics

  1. Open Analytics panel
  2. Click Traffic
  3. Click Geography
  4. Select date range (data available from January 2014)

Key Features

Interactive Heat Map:

  • Shows visitor volume by country, region, and city
  • Darker shades indicate higher visit volumes
  • Hover over areas to see exact visitor numbers
  • Click to zoom into specific regions

Data Table:

  • Mirrors map navigation
  • Shows locations with >0 visits
  • Sortable by number of visits
  • Provides detailed regional and city-level data

Important Notes:

  • "Unknown" locations occur when IP addresses don't provide location data
  • Geographic data might differ from Google Analytics due to different IP address interpretation methods
  • Heat map data updates automatically based on selected time frame
